Network wiring services involve installing, updating, or repairing the structured cabling that connects various electronic devices within a property. This includes setting up Ethernet cables, data ports, and network switches to ensure reliable internet and network access throughout a home or commercial space. Proper wiring helps create a stable and efficient network environment, reducing connectivity issues and supporting multiple devices such as computers, smart TVs, security systems, and smart home technology.
These services are essential for resolving common problems like slow internet speeds, frequent disconnections, or insufficient coverage in certain areas of a property. Outdated or improperly installed wiring can lead to network congestion or weak signals, making it difficult to stream, work remotely, or operate smart devices effectively. Professional network wiring can optimize the layout of data cables, eliminate dead zones, and provide a more dependable connection that meets the demands of modern digital lifestyles.

The overview below groups typical Network Wiring proj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Minor wiring fixes or upgrades typically cost between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the complexity of the repair and the materials needed.
Standard Installations - Installing new network wiring for a home or small office generally ranges from $600 to $1,500. Most projects in this category are straightforward and stay within this middle range.
Full Network Rewiring - Larger, more comprehensive rewiring projects can cost $2,000 to $5,000 or more. These tend to be less common and involve extensive work to upgrade or replace entire systems.
Complex or Commercial Projects - Complex network wiring for larger commercial spaces can exceed $5,000, depending on size and requirements. Such projects are less frequent but handled by experienced local contractors for larger-scale need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
